The JavaScript Anthology: 101 Essential Tips, Tricks & Hacks - Softcover

9780975240267: The JavaScript Anthology: 101 Essential Tips, Tricks & Hacks
View all copies of this ISBN edition:
 
 

Using a cookbook approach, The JavaScript Anthology will show you how to apply JavaScript to solve over 101 common Web Development challenges. You'll discover how-to:

  • Optimize your code so that it runs faster
  • Create Ajax applications with the XmlHttpRequest object
  • Validate web forms to improve usability
  • Take control of your web pages with the DOM
  • Ensure that your JavaScript code is accessible
  • Create slick drop-down menu systems
  • Included in this book is extensive coverage of DHTML and Ajax, including how-to create and customize advanced effects such as draggable elements, dynamically sorting data in a Web Browser, advanced menu systems, retrieving data from a Web Server using XMLHttpRequest and more.

    The JavaScript Anthology also includes extensive coverage of object oriented coding, efficient script design, accessibility, and cross-browser issues. Best of all, you'll get download access to all the code used in the book, so you can put the scripts to use instantly.

    From the Publisher

    "Take control with the ultimate JavaScript toolkit"

    The JavaScript Anthology: 101 Essential Tips, Tricks & Hacks provides you with tried and tested real-world solutions to over 100 real-world scripting problems.

    Among the 101 Tips, Tricks & Hacks you'll learn how-to:

    • Search and replace text using regular expressions.
    • Navigate the DOM and create, delete, and move elements on the page.
    • Validate email addresses on your web forms.
    • Print inline error messages when validating forms.
    • Minimize the problems associated with popup windows.
    • Make a slideshow of images.
    • Ensure your code works on different browsers.
    • Make a style sheet switcher.
    • Build an accessible drop-down menu system.
    • Construct drag 'n' drop interfaces using AJAX.
    • Use JavaScript and Flash together.
    • Make your JavaScript accessible: an in-depth look at minimizing the accessibility problems associated with using JavaScript.
    • Use the XMLHttpRequest object to build AJAX applications.
    • Optimize your JavaScript code so that it runs faster.
    • And much more!


    Who Should Read This Book?

    If you're using JavaScript on your projects right now, and you want to do things faster and better, this book is for you. The JavaScript Anthology will save you the frustration of hunting down code on the Web only to find that it isn't customizable, and doesn't represent best practice or work across different browsers.

    The JavaScript Anthology: 101 Essential Tips, Tricks & Hacks contains thoroughly tested, cross-browser code that you can easily modify to suit your own needs.

    The book is written in the usual SitePoint style: it's clear and fun to read, with plenty of example code that you can apply immediately to your own web sites. Plus, it's super-easy to navigate the book to find exactly what you want thanks to its cookbook approach and professionally-produced index. It's the perfect reference book.

    There's no need to re-type any of the code in the book. As always, customers receive instant download access to all the files used in the book, so you can apply them immediately to your own projects.

    "synopsis" may belong to another edition of this title.

    About the Author:

    Cameron Adams is an author of multiple web development books and is often referred to as a "Web Technologist." In addition to his extensive JavaScript experience, Cameron's passions extend to CSS, PHP, and graphic design.



    JAMES EDWARDS is a Nortel Networks Certified Support Specialist (NNCSS) in VPN Routers. His experience includes work with some of Nortel's largest enterprise customers.

    RICHARD BRAMANTE, also a Nortel Networks Certified Support Specialist (NNCSS), has been in Nortel VPN Router support for three years, and was a technology lead on the Instant Internet.

    AL MARTIN is a technical writer with 15 years of experience in electro-mechanical and computer-related disciplines.

    "About this title" may belong to another edition of this title.

    • PublisherSitePoint
    • Publication date2006
    • ISBN 10 0975240269
    • ISBN 13 9780975240267
    • BindingPaperback
    • Edition number1
    • Number of pages592
    • Rating

    Shipping: US$ 13.96
    From United Kingdom to U.S.A.

    Destination, rates & speeds

    Add to Basket

    Top Search Results from the AbeBooks Marketplace

    Seller Image

    Adams, Cameron; Edwards, James
    Published by SitePoint (2006)
    ISBN 10: 0975240269 ISBN 13: 9780975240267
    New Soft cover First Edition Quantity: 1
    Seller:
    M.Roberts - Books And ??????
    (Slaithwaite, Huddersfield, HUDD, United Kingdom)

    Book Description Soft cover. Condition: New. 1st Edition. The JavaScript Anthology: 101 Essential Tips, Tricks & Hacks.Adams, Cameron; Edwards, James.Condition:New, may have slight storage wear. Seller Inventory # 006712

    More information about this seller | Contact seller

    Buy New
    US$ 17.97
    Convert currency

    Add to Basket

    Shipping: US$ 13.96
    From United Kingdom to U.S.A.
    Destination, rates & speeds
    Stock Image

    Adams, Cameron, Edwards, James
    Published by SitePoint (2006)
    ISBN 10: 0975240269 ISBN 13: 9780975240267
    New Paperback Quantity: 1
    Seller:
    The Book Spot
    (Sioux Falls, SD, U.S.A.)

    Book Description Paperback. Condition: New. Seller Inventory # Abebooks408868

    More information about this seller | Contact seller

    Buy New
    US$ 59.00
    Convert currency

    Add to Basket

    Shipping: FREE
    Within U.S.A.
    Destination, rates & speeds
    Stock Image

    Adams, Cameron; Edwards, James
    Published by SitePoint (2006)
    ISBN 10: 0975240269 ISBN 13: 9780975240267
    New Softcover Quantity: 1
    Seller:
    BennettBooksLtd
    (North Las Vegas, NV, U.S.A.)

    Book Description Condition: New. New. In shrink wrap. Looks like an interesting title! 2.05. Seller Inventory # Q-0975240269

    More information about this seller | Contact seller

    Buy New
    US$ 96.89
    Convert currency

    Add to Basket

    Shipping: US$ 5.65
    Within U.S.A.
    Destination, rates & speeds